What is the Role of a Blade Truck Mounted Attenuator in Roadway Safety?
Blade truck mounted attenuators (TMAs) are specifically designed to reduce the impact of crashes, thereby minimizing the risk of fatalities and injuries on the roads. These essential safety devices act as crash cushions, absorbing the energy of an impacting vehicle and providing a protective barrier for both highway workers and motorists. TMAs are commonly used in highway construction zones due to their effectiveness in mitigating the consequences of collisions.
The blade TMA is distinct in its design, offering advanced safety features that are engineered to optimize impact absorption. By providing a sturdy yet energy-dissipating barrier, blade TMAs reduce the severity of collisions and ensure safer work zones for all.

Why Are Blade Truck Mounted Attenuators Essential in Work Zone Safety?
Blade TMAs serve as reliable crash cushions in work zones, acting as a protective shield for highway workers and drivers navigating through construction areas. These safety devices play a vital role in preventing collisions on highways by absorbing the impact of errant vehicles and minimizing the potential for fatalities. The importance of MASH-certified TMAs in work zone safety regulations cannot be understated, as these certifications ensure that the attenuators meet stringent safety standards.
The strategic deployment of blade TMAs in high-risk areas not only protects lives but also ensures smoother traffic flow, reducing delays caused by accidents and enhancing overall efficiency in construction zones.
